by David Davis (Author), Herb Leonhard (Illustrator)

Mother Goose heads down south!


This collection of forty-six original poems imbues popular nursery rhymes with a Southern twang. Beginning readers will encounter Chattahoochee Charlie, Miami Mary, Little Hannah from Savannah, Old King Cajun, and many more characters from across the South. Y'all better be ready for rambunctious personalities, beloved rhymes, and charming illustrations on every page!

Mother Goose flies way down south in this Southern take on popular nursery rhymes. The twang in this collection of forty-six poems adapted from the verses we all know and love will have readers donning their NASCARï¿1/2 caps or listening to the ole' banjo in no time.

Young'uns encounter the tales of Old Mother Hubbard pulling cornbread from her cupboard and her hound that turns down biscuits. Have a picky eater, too? Dine with Peter the praline-eater or have boiled peanuts by the sea! Meet the Mississippi mosquito that munches on grits and fried green tomatoes instead of those sweet ole' southerners and Yankee Doodle who stays down South and trades in his pony for a pickup. Find out what happens to the crawfish as they "rub-a-dub-dub" in their tub! Tap your feet to a tune or two as you read along with Little Boy Bluegrass or fiddle high and low with Boyd and Ben.

Y'all should tease your hair and get ready for a sensational journey. Whether reading one or all, these beloved rhymes ooze with charm and the clever humor of author David Davis and charming illustrations of Herb Leonhard.

David Davis is a humorist, cartoonist, speaker, and writer with a flair for storytelling. He is the author of Pelican's Ten Redneck Babies: A Southern Counting Book and Jazz Cats, which were named to the Children's Choice Top 100 List. Davis is also the author of numerous titles in Pelican's Night Before Christmas Series and Texas Zeke and The Longhorn, Rock 'n' Roll Dogs, Texas Mother Goose, Texas Aesop's Fables, A Southern Child's Garden of Verses, and The Twelve Days of Christmas-in Texas, That Is, all published by Pelican. A popular speaker at educational conferences, libraries, and schools, Davis lives in Fort Worth, Texas.

Herb Leonhard is an award-winning illustrator and graphic designer whose work appears on magazine and album covers, greeting cards, posters, and calendars. He is also the illustrator of Pelican's St. Patrick and the Three Brave Mice, Way Out West on My Little Pony, A Southern Child's Garden of Verses, Leonardo's Monster, I Know a Librarian Who Chewed on a Word, and A Is for Alliguitar: Musical Alphabeasts. Leonhard lives with his wife and son in Prosser, Washington.
